- Executive Search & Leadership Hiring:
Own executive and senior leadership hiring, personally leading critical searches while managing and leveraging external search firms. Partner with founders and hiring managers on role definition, assessment, and closing and set the standard for executive hiring across the company. - Hiring Strategy & Bar Setting:
Own end‑to‑end hiring outcomes and set a consistently high bar across all roles, partnering closely with leaders to ensure rigorous assessment and strong hiring decisions. - Leadership & Team Building:
Build, lead, and mentor a high‑performing Talent Acquisition team. Create clarity around roles, expectations, and performance while fostering a culture of ownership and excellence. - Hiring Process & Infrastructure:
Design scalable recruiting processes. Use data to diagnose funnel health, improve decision‑making and continuously iterate on hiring effectiveness. - Candidate Experience & Employer Brand:
Ensure a high‑touch, thoughtful candidate experience. Shape and communicate a compelling employer story in partnership with leadership and brand partners. - Stakeholder Partnership:
Build deep, trusted relationships with founders and hiring managers, serving as a trusted advisor throughout the hiring process.
- Executive Search
Experience:
10+ years of experience in Talent Acquisition and/or Executive Search, with proven experience leading executive search end‑to‑end either from a top search firm or in‑house and a track record of closing senior leaders in competitive markets. - People Leadership
Experience:
Proven experience leading and scaling Talent Acquisition teams, including hiring, developing, and managing recruiters, and operating as a player‑coach in a high‑growth environment. - Technical Recruiting Expertise:
Hands‑on experience hiring technical talent, with the ability to partner credibly with technical leaders. - Startup & High‑Growth
Experience:
Experience building or scaling recruiting functions in a startup or high‑growth environment, where ambiguity and speed are the norm. - Strategic & Operational Strength:
Ability to zoom out to define long‑term hiring strategy while staying hands‑on with critical searches and day‑to‑day execution. - Exceptional Communication & Judgment:
Strong executive presence, stakeholder management skills, and sound judgment in high‑stakes hiring decisions. - Thrive in Ambiguity:
Comfort operating with incomplete information, prioritizing ruthlessly, and creating structure where none exists.
